Perrysburg Dodgeboy wrote:
Ram is the first truck maker to announce that its full lineup of pickups adheres to the criteria, so you can expect others to follow suit shortly. "Ram Truck has been preparing for integration of the SAE towing standard over the past few years and adding heavier 3/4- and 1-ton trucks to the criteria gives it more teeth," said Mike Cairns, director of Ram truck engineering, in a statement. "For too long, an uneven playing field existed and towing capacities went unchecked. We're happy to be the only pickup truck manufacturer to align with the SAE J2807 towing standard across our pickup truck lineup."
And check this out, Ram 1500 V-6 with 3.0-liter EcoDiesel: best-in-class 9,200 pounds. Looks like I'm good to go with the 8,300# GWR TT Mama and I are looking at.
